John Mundia Nyoike is a legal expert with over 8 years of experience in litigation, legal programming, and human rights advocacy. He has represented dozens of victims of human rights violations before Kenyan courts, securing access to justice for vulnerable and marginalized communities. Mundia is also an accomplished international speaker who has presented at numerous regional and international conferences, forums, and professional meetings on issues relating to business and human rights, tax justice, and media law. He is a skilled legal trainer, an astute researcher, and a strategic network builder. He holds a Bachelor of Laws (LL.B) degree from the University of Nairobi and a Postgraduate Diploma in Law from the Kenya School of Law. John is a member of the East Africa Law Society and currently serves on its Business and Human Rights Committee, where he contributes to advancing responsible business conduct and the protection of human rights within the region.
